Output 2847c56a521da376de0cbd55a3f42ea617e9aec9ca8dac3033ed226ae720fa95:18

value
3990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baf94bd3e8ea5b41662370c3d6e2ebc0d6f485e5 OP_EQUAL
address
3JjeFdNsYC6LDnAor7XFoUtxF6DKJBdESe
transaction
2847c56a521da376de0cbd55a3f42ea617e9aec9ca8dac3033ed226ae720fa95
spent
true